no i po co oni takie wtf-aki trzymają w tym języku?
@dixx: bo jeśli robisz: String s = "Dawid"; java sprawdza czy taki string juz istnieje, jesli tak, ustawia na niego referencje zamiast tworzyć nowy obiekt.
korzyści? string jest bezpieczny wątkowo, JVM może cachować jego hashcode zamiast go przeliczać za każdym razem więc jest wydajny jako klucz w hashmapie.
W przedszkolu mojego syna dzieci dostały zadanie. Zadanie polegało na tym żeby narysować sport, który najbardziej lubią. Dzieci jak to dzieci, ktoś narysował piłkę nożną, koszykówkę, jazdę na rowerze itp Mój syn narysował stół z czerwonymi i kolorowymi kuleczkami, dwóch panów z kijami i jednego pana obok. Na pytanie nauczycielki - co to za sport? mój syn odpowiedział -
Mieszkaliście kiedyś w tak wspaniałym domu jednorodzinnym, że wyjazd z podwórka miał własną sygnalizację świetlną a piesi musieli czekać na zielone światło, aby móc przejść przed waszą furtką? W #krakow jest to możliwe. Nie pytajcie mnie o logikę albo sens. Nawet namalowali linię zatrzymań.
@pasztet_w_lasce: @pestis: jak byście mieszkali w tym domku to zrobilibyście impreze/grilla w ogródku na tyłach? Troche lipa jak cały blok się patrzy :)
Mój syn po kąpieli zaczął płakać ze ma mokre włosy. Wiedziałem ze łatwo nie odpuści ale nie chciało mi się wyciągać suszarki, tym bardziej ze miał je tylko trochę wilgotne na końcach. Powiedziałem mu żeby stanął przy kaloryferze to szybko wyschną xD #heheszki #zonabijealewolnobiega
Mam córkę, 5 lat, którą staram się trzymać dość twardo. Uczę ją po prostu, by za każdym razem jak tylko coś jej jest nie tak, to żeby nie płakała, tylko starała się ból przezwyciężyć i zachować spokój. Pewnego razu, jesienią, wracałam z nią z zakupów. Moja córka, jako pomocnica mamusi, niosła dwie małe torebki w obydwu rączkach. Po wejściu na klatkę schodową trzeba
uwaga #boldupy: CH* w D* "devsom", którzy w swoich paczkach robią rewolucje na masterze!!! Wyebało projekt, szukam, kombinuje a tu się okazało, że koleś pozmieniał sobie kluczowe rzeczy. Na masterze!!! Zero developa, zero tagów, zero innych gałęzi. Zero myślenia. #w---w
Miałem test dzisiaj. I pytanie co będzie na wyjściu:
String s = new String("Dawid");
Gdyby przykład był nieco inny, to miałbyś rację co do ==, mianowicie:
String s = "Dawid";@dixx: bo jeśli robisz:
String s = "Dawid";
java sprawdza czy taki string juz istnieje, jesli tak, ustawia na niego referencje zamiast tworzyć nowy obiekt.
korzyści? string jest bezpieczny wątkowo, JVM może cachować jego hashcode zamiast go przeliczać za każdym razem więc jest wydajny jako klucz w hashmapie.